Purpose of a Conclusion for an Informative Essay. The conclusion is the last thing your reader will read about your topic, which is why it needs to pack a powerful punch to make it relevant and memorable. The goal of your conclusion should be to eloquently summarize the content of your essay, but you should aim to do so in a way that the reader is likely to remember. An informative essay is a type of academic assignment, given to high school and college students to test the way they can provide information on a specific topic (global warming, hate crime, discrimination, fast-food, obesity, etc.). 20 Essay Conclusion Examples to Help You Finish Strong Essay conclusions are pretty simple once you know the framework. It all boils down to three main parts: a transition from the last body paragraph, a summary of the thesis statement and main points of the essay, and a closing statement that wraps everything up. If all students knew this simple formula, maybe essay writing would be easier for everyone. How to Write an Informative Essay: An Outline and Basic Rules
